Gendering the International Asylum and Refugee Debate 1st ed. 2007 edition
J. Freedman
Gendering the International Asylum and Refugee Debate 1st ed. 2007 edition
J. Freedman
This study provides a comprehensive account of the situation of women refugees globally and explains how they differ from men. It looks at causes of refugee flows, international laws and conventions and their application, the policies and legislation of Western governments, and lived experiences of the refugees themselves.
